Les prix sont affichés en haut avant le formulaire de création du dyndnspro. Vous pouvez tester le dyndnspro pendant une dizaine de jours avant de payer. ceci suppose que vous possediez votre propre nom de domaine internet. Sinon, vous pouvez tester en choisissant un dyndnspro en sous domaine dyndnspro.com. Il est fortement conseillé pour les entreprises qinsi que pour les sites interessant d'utiliser un dyndnspro attaché à un domaine internet.
Pour utiliser votre routeur directement avec dyndnspro.com, il faut que le menu de configuration du routeur contienne dyndnspro.com comme serveur de dns dynamique. Si ce n'est pas le cas, installer directement le dyndnsproclient sur votre pc (voir rubrique téléchargement). N'oubliez pas aussi de rédiriger les ports concernés (80 pour web http) vers le pc où votre serveur web ou autre est installé (voir le menu redirection ou forwarding ou Nat de votre routeur).
Si votre routeur accèpte le service dns dynamique
de dyndnspro.com, configurez le comme suit :
-
Nom de serveur : dyndns.dyndnspro.com
Port : 2000 ou 80 ou 8080 ou 8245
Protocol : web
Domaine :
Login : <votre nom de domaine >
Mot de passe : <Votre mot de passe dyndnspro
>
Vous pouvez aussi utilisez un url comme le suivant pour mettre à jour votre ip : http://dyndns.dyndnspro.com/update.php?hostname=<votre domaine>&pass=<mot mot de passe domaine>&subdoms=<les sous domaines>&mx=<nom du serveur mail>
Exemple1 : http://dyndns.dyndnspro.com/update.php?hostname=nab.dyndnspro.com&pass=abcd
Exemple2 : http://dyndns.dyndnspro.com/update.php?hostname=dodo.com&pass=abcd&subdoms=news;ft;camera&mx=1
Exemple3 : http://dyndns.dyndnspro.com/update.php?hostname=dodo.com&pass=abcd&subdoms=news;ft;camera&mx=mail.coco.com
Exemple3 : http://dyndns.dyndnspro.com/update.php?hostname=dodo.com&pass=abcd&myip=139.19.78.100
Dans le deuxième exemple; le serveur email sera email.dodo.com et les sous domaines sont : news.dodo.com , ftp.dodo.com ; camera.dodo.com. Par contre, le troisiême exemple définit mail.coco.com comme serveur email.
Les sous-domaines www, ftp sont défini par défaut. On ne peut pas définir des sous-domaines du domaine .dyndnspro.com
Dans l'exemple numéro 3, myip est votre ip. L'ip est par défaut l'adresse du client ou du navigateur qui a envoyé cette requête.
$cat updatedyndnspro.phpExemple en php sous linux :
<?php
$pass="abcd";
$hostname="mondomaine.fr";
$uri="hostname=$hostname&pass=$pass";
$uri=urlencode($uri);
$site="http://dyndns.dyndnspro.com/update.php?" . $uri;
$df=fopen($site,"r");
if($df)
{
$buf=fgets($df,200);
echo $buf;
fclose($df);
}
?>
Ensuite, faite la commande 'crontab -e' et insérer la ligne suivante (verte) :
*/10 * * * * /usr/bin/php updatedyndnspro.php
La commande php peut être aussi dans /usr/local/bin.
Ici, linux va mettre à jour l'ip du domaine toute les 10 minutes.
Exemple en shell sous linux/unix (crontab) :
$hostn="votre domaine"
$pass="votre mot de passe dyndns"
*/10 * * * * wget http://dyndns.dyndnspro.com/update.php?hostname=$hostn&pass=$pass
Si le routeur box ne comporte pas la config dyndnspro.com
Dans ce cas, Allez à cette page